Cascina means farmhouse in the Italian language – a welcoming structure typically found in the rolling vineyards of Italy, exuding warmth and bursting with delicious food, excellent wines and sincere hospitality. One step inside Cascina Ristorante and you are quickly transported from the hustle and bustle of Hell’s Kitchen to such an Italian retreat. Enjoy simple, yet flavorful, country-style food and award winning wine that comes directly from the Cascina-Orsolina Vineyard in the Piemonte region of Italy. Guests particularly enjoy Cascina’s homemade breads, pastas and desserts, and the restaurant’s signature pizzas that are baked in a wood-fired stone oven. In addition to its delicious food, Cascina features an impressive wine list and the largest collection of grappa in New York City.
